- Michael Rapaport wurde am 20 März 1970 in New York City, New York, USA geboren. Er ist Schauspieler und Regisseur, bekannt für Deep Blue Sea (1999), Beautiful Girls (1996) und True Romance (1993). Er ist seit 2016 mit Kebe Dunn verheiratet. Er war mit Nichole Beattie verheiratet.

- Pleaded guilty to aggravated harassment of Lili Taylor. Ordered to stay away from her and get counseling for a year.
- As a youngster, he was a die-hard fan of Eddie Murphy and used to dress up like him in gold chains and white suits. He later got to work with his idol in the film Metro (1997) and on Dr. Dolittle 2 (2001).
- Has a son named Maceo Shane, born in 2002. He named his son after Vincent Mason aka Maseo of De La Soul.
- Has a son named Julian Ali, born in 2000.
- Lost to Gary Dell'Abate in the final round of the Howard Stern Staff Fantasy Football League in 2014.

- (2011, on being a part of Frank Zappa's Civilization, Phaze III) I used to date Moon Zappa. She's a good friend of mine still. He used to get a kick out of the way I used to speak, so he was like, "Yo, you wanna come down there and talk on this album?" We went down there and I talked on the album, and I felt like it was cool 'cause he was Frank Zappa, and I was Mike Rappa. That's what we used to joke. I used to always get a kick out of him, and I think he used to get a kick out of me.
